								<p><a class="mention" href="/u/garrison" rel="nofollow">@garrison</a> already made some very good points. We don’t plan to make complex JS commands.</p>
<aside class="quote no-group" data-username="garrison" data-post="8" data-topic="65504">
<div class="title">
<div class="quote-controls"></div>
<img alt="" width="24" height="24" src="https://forum.elixirforum.com/letter_avatar_proxy/v4/letter/g/3bc359/48.png" class="avatar"> garrison:</div>
<blockquote>
<p>I think a much better path forward would be to continue to improve hooks for use cases like these. In particular, I don’t understand why there’s no good API for setting sticky attributes/classes the way JS commands do via the client-side hooks APIs.</p>
</blockquote>
</aside>
<p>There are lots of improvements planned for hooks. One of them is to actually expose sticky JS commands like this:</p>
<pre data-code-wrap="javascript"><code class="lang-javascript">mounted() {
  const js = this.js();
  // js.show, js.hide, js.transition, etc.
  js.toggleClass(this.el, ...);
}
</code></pre>
<p>Another big improvement will be colocated hooks that will allow defining the necessary JavaScript next to the components themselves.</p>

								<p>which API do you refer to? <code>getBoundingClientRect</code>? If that’s the case then no, we don’t work on it and we also wouldn’t want to expose this through <code>Phoenix.LiveView.JS</code>.</p>
<p>For the other stuff mentioned: the PR for sticky ops in hooks is here <a href="https://github.com/phoenixframework/phoenix_live_view/pull/3307" class="inline-onebox" rel="noopener nofollow ugc">Extend client with createHook, js client commands, and lock/unlock support by chrismccord · Pull Request #3307 · phoenixframework/phoenix_live_view · GitHub</a>. I don’t know what Chris is up to at the moment, but that’s the one to follow for that.</p>
<p>Concerning colocated hooks that’s probably something for after 1.0.</p>
